Blanche Sauzeau DuBois 1684–1739 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 1684
Birth Location: Marennes, Charente-Maritime, Poitou-Charentes, France
Death Date: 31 Jan 1739
Death Location: Manhattan, New York County (Manhattan), New York, United States of America
Father: Jacques DuBois
Mother: Blanche Sauzeau
Spouse(s): Rene Het
Children(s): Mary Het
In 1684, Blanche Sauzeau DuBois entered the world in Marennes, Charente-Maritime, Poitou-Charentes, France, born to Jacques Dubois And Blanche Madam Sauzeau. Blanche Sauzeau DuBois married Rene Het, and had children including Mary Dubois Het. Blanche Sauzeau DuBois passed away in 1739 in Manhattan, New York County (Manhattan), New York, United States of America.
